The instructions say the engine mount holes in the firewall may not match up with the engine mount, but to use the engine mount as a guide to enlarge the holes to 3/8”. When I did this the bit centered itself on the pre punched hole and pulled the engine mount over the hole even with the mount bolted in place at the first hole. So the engine mount holes still don’t line up with the holes in the firewall. I was able to pull the engine mount enough by hand (no pusher clamps) to get all 4 bolts installed. Is this acceptable? If not, what’s the fix? Thanks

For the next person, holes can be realigned with a circular or "chainsaw" file. Go slow and take your time, one can get a hole easily moved in any direction. Probably best to finish with the file slightly undersize and finish it off with the proper sized drill bit to ensure it's a proper circle.
